A 13.9 gallon gas tank is 4/5 full. How many gallons will it take to fill the tank?

It will take 2.78 gallons to fill the remainder of the tank.

13.9 * 4/5 = 11.12    - 11.12 is the amount of gas already in the tank.

13.9 - 11.12 = 2.78    - So, subtract 11.12 from 13.9 and you get your answer.
